Just remove the motor screw at the end with the wire. {If you have a brush, be sure to remove the end with the wire, because the end without the wire has a commutator, and you can't knock out the motor. Both ends of the brushless motor can be removed, but to prevent the motor wire from being hit, the wired end is generally opened. Motors with gears are special, so be sure to pay attention. Some are opened at the wired side, and some are opened without wires. The end is open! } Turn on the motor three to four times. Don't knock it hard all at once, as the end cover of the motor may be easily broken! Generally, it will be difficult to open the motor if it has been exposed to water and is rusty. Knock it out slowly, and be sure to pay attention to the threads on the motor shaft head so as not to deform the screw threads.
